Ever done a comp trip to Grand Biloxi casino?

by  |  earlier

0 LIKES UnLike

We received a flyer in the mail for a comp trip to the Grand in Biloxi. The trip includes airfare, transportation to and from the airport, and hotel accommodations at the casino for Fri-Sun. Since I have heard that this is a very small casino, is there any type of penalty if we leave and spend most of our time at, say, Hard Rock? Would this be frowned upon by the Grand?

  1. You might never get a comp from the Grand again but that is about it.

    My last trip to Vegas the Venetian comped me but I didn't gamble at all because I had some friends with me and one was underage and not allowed on the floor. Nothing happened. I can still get comps even but if I did it a couple of times they would probably stop giving me free stuff.

    Now if you accept the comp and don't even check into the hotel then they will charge you for the room. You don't have to gamble. You don't have to spend time in the Grand. But you do have to actually show up.


  2. Casinos give out comps under the assumption that you will spend a specific amount of time at their casino, and thus they will win more money off of you than they are giving out. But under no circumstances are you in any was obligated to spend your time or money at their casino after you've been comped. It is perfectly fine to go somewhere else and play, just do not expect to be comped as much in the future if you are not spending a significant amount of time playing in their casino. Of course, if you're spending a lot of time (and money) gambling at Hard Rock, they may be the ones sending you the offers for free trips in the future.
